How to fill out the NY DTF IT-203-D online

Filling out the NY DTF IT-203-D form is an essential step for nonresident and part-year resident taxpayers in New York who wish to claim itemized deductions. This guide provides clear instructions on how to complete the form efficiently and accurately online.

Follow the steps to complete the NY DTF IT-203-D form online.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access the form and open it in your preferred online editor.
  2. Enter your name or the names as they appear on your Form IT-203 in the designated field at the top of the form.
  3. Input your social security number in the specified section, ensuring accuracy without omitting any digits.
  4. Fill out each line under the medical and dental expenses, taxes you paid, and other relevant deductions, based on your federal Schedule A. Remember to use whole dollars only.
  5. For line 9, report any state, local, and foreign income taxes or applicable general sales tax, as described in the instructions.
  6. Subtract the amount on line 9 from the amount on line 8 and record the result on line 10.
  7. Complete line 11 with the college tuition itemized deduction, according to the details provided in the instructions.
  8. Read through the instructions carefully to enter any addition adjustments on line 12.
  9. Add the totals from lines 10, 11, and 12, and write the sum on line 13.
  10. Calculate the itemized deduction adjustment as instructed and enter this on line 14.
  11. Finally, subtract line 14 from line 13 to determine the New York State itemized deduction. This total should be entered on Form IT-203, line 33.

The NYS IT 201 form is for full-year residents, while the IT 203 form is intended for non-residents and part-year residents. This distinction affects how you report your income and calculate your taxes. If you qualify under the NY DTF IT-203-D, it’s essential to use the correct form to ensure accurate reporting.
